What is a Special Power of Attorney?
A Special Power of Attorney is a legal document that empowers an individual, known as the attorney-in-fact, to manage specific financial affairs on behalf of the principal. In Canada, this document holds significant importance as it allows designated individuals to handle transactions that the principal may not be able to perform due to various reasons, such as traveling or health issues. The unique aspect of a Special Power of Attorney becomes apparent at the Philippine Consulate in Winnipeg, where it can be utilized for purposes tailored to expatriates.
This document authorizes the attorney-in-fact to undertake actions such as collecting funds, signing checks, and making transactions concerning the principal's assets. Understanding the functions of this document is crucial for anyone considering appointing an attorney-in-fact.

Who is eligible to complete the Special Power of Attorney in Canada?
Any adult Canadian resident can complete the Special Power of Attorney, provided they understand the implications and requirements of the document, including the necessity for notarization.
What documents do I need to submit with the Special Power of Attorney?
Generally, you will need identification documents for both the principal and the attorney-in-fact, as well as the completed Special Power of Attorney form for notarization at the Philippine Consulate.
How do I submit the Special Power of Attorney once completed?
You must submit the completed Special Power of Attorney to the appropriate financial institutions or parties involved, and ensure it is notarized if required.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out the form?
Common mistakes include leaving fields blank, misnaming the attorney-in-fact, and failing to sign the document. Always double-check for accuracy.
Is there a deadline for submitting the Special Power of Attorney?
There is typically no strict deadline for completing the form, but it should be filed as soon as possible to ensure timely execution of the powers granted.
How long does the notarization process take?
The notarization process at the Philippine Consulate General can typically be done on the same day, but it's advisable to check for specific waiting times.
Can I revoke a Special Power of Attorney after it has been executed?
Yes, a Special Power of Attorney can be revoked at any time by the principal, as long as they are mentally competent and can follow the proper legal process for revocation.
